Marks
Sub-specialties: Tyres, Tools, Footwear, Packaging &
manufacturing, Feature comparison
The specialty of marks covers a very wide area
and encompasses many forms of examination. It includes a range of
well-established evidence types including the comparison of marks
made by footwear, tyres and tools.
The objective is to reach a view on whether or not a particular
item was responsible for a specific mark. The examiner is concerned
with visualisation, assessment and comparison of detail to
interpret the findings.
Another area covered by this specialty is the examination of
packaging and other manufactured items to determine the degree of
association between items and to assess whether or not they were
from the same original source. This includes examinations of
extruded material such as plastic bags and film as well as items
that are manufactured by other processes. The examiner studies
various macroscopic and microscopic features to formulate an
opinion.
